Item Description... Overview Our God is a God of order and divine arrangement, and He desires that all things be headed up in Christ (Eph. 1:10). In opposition to the divine will, there is rebellion and chaos in God's creation due to the fall of humanity. According to God's divine arrangement, the reestablishment of order in the universe is centered on the relationship between Christ, the Head, and the Church, His Body. Christ has been made Head over all things to the Church (Eph. 1:22), and the living excercise of authority and submission within the Body of Christ is central to the working out of God's divine will.
In Authority and Submission, Watchman Nee presents many helpful principles and examples from the Holy Scriptures related to the proper exercise of both authority and submission, an exercise that is according to the divine life in the Body of Christ. |
